diff options
author | Benjamin Kosnik <bkoz@redhat.com> | 2001-06-30 04:35:49 +0000 |
---|---|---|
committer | Benjamin Kosnik <bkoz@gcc.gnu.org> | 2001-06-30 04:35:49 +0000 |
commit | 13f83598b3043f628ed46297dd49f5c0ef46ffa8 (patch) | |
tree | 995ded702483dea4d437f12cb2404f0b4cc96c79 /gcc/errors.c | |
parent | 8f1ae09ac2d66b503fa48b09dc3780180650224e (diff) | |
download | gcc-13f83598b3043f628ed46297dd49f5c0ef46ffa8.zip gcc-13f83598b3043f628ed46297dd49f5c0ef46ffa8.tar.gz gcc-13f83598b3043f628ed46297dd49f5c0ef46ffa8.tar.bz2 |
locale_facets.tcc (locale::combine): Clone _Impl.
2001-06-29 Benjamin Kosnik <bkoz@redhat.com>
* include/bits/locale_facets.tcc (locale::combine): Clone _Impl.
before replacing facet.
* include/bits/localefwd.h (locale::_Impl::_M_remove_reference):
Correct decrement.
* src/localename.cc (locale::_Impl): Correct ctor initialization
lists. Initialize ref count with one. Simplify.
* src/locale.cc: Add comment.
* testsuite/22_locale/numpunct.cc (test01): Add derivation test.
* testsuite/22_locale/numpunct_char_members.cc (test01): Add tests.
* testsuite/22_locale/members.cc (test02): Fix.
From-SVN: r43661
Diffstat (limited to 'gcc/errors.c')
0 files changed, 0 insertions, 0 deletions